Illegal Restraint
A legal term referring to any action or practice that restricts trade or the free movement of goods, services, or people unlawfully.
United Mine Workers
A labor union that represents coal miners in the United States and Canada, founded in 1890, advocating for improved working conditions and wages.
Consumerism
The cultural phenomenon characterized by the acquisition of goods and services in ever-increasing amounts, often driven by advertising and societal norms.
Installment Plans
Payment methods that allow consumers to make purchases and pay for them in set amounts over a specified period.
